Class ResponseUtils
java.lang.Object
org.apache.myfaces.tobago.internal.util.ResponseUtils
-
Method Summary
Modifier and TypeMethodDescriptionstatic voidensureContentSecurityPolicyHeader(jakarta.faces.context.FacesContext facesContext, ContentSecurityPolicy contentSecurityPolicy) static voidensureContentTypeHeader(jakarta.faces.context.FacesContext facesContext, String contentType) static voidensureContentTypeHeader(jakarta.servlet.http.HttpServletResponse response, String contentType) static voidensureNoCacheHeader(jakarta.faces.context.FacesContext facesContext) static voidensureNoCacheHeader(jakarta.servlet.http.HttpServletResponse response) static voidensureNosniffHeader(jakarta.faces.context.FacesContext facesContext) static voidensureNosniffHeader(jakarta.servlet.http.HttpServletResponse servletResponse) static voidensureXFrameOptionsHeader(jakarta.faces.context.FacesContext facesContext) Deprecated, for removal: This API element is subject to removal in a future version.Remove X-Frame-Options HTTP header, because it is covered by the CSP directive "frame-ancestors".static voidpragmaHeader(jakarta.servlet.http.HttpServletResponse response) Deprecated, for removal: This API element is subject to removal in a future version.
-
Method Details
-
ensureNoCacheHeader
public static void ensureNoCacheHeader(jakarta.faces.context.FacesContext facesContext) -
ensureNoCacheHeader
public static void ensureNoCacheHeader(jakarta.servlet.http.HttpServletResponse response) -
pragmaHeader
@Deprecated(since="6.11.0", forRemoval=true) public static void pragmaHeader(jakarta.servlet.http.HttpServletResponse response) Deprecated, for removal: This API element is subject to removal in a future version. -
ensureContentTypeHeader
public static void ensureContentTypeHeader(jakarta.faces.context.FacesContext facesContext, String contentType) -
ensureContentTypeHeader
public static void ensureContentTypeHeader(jakarta.servlet.http.HttpServletResponse response, String contentType) -
ensureContentSecurityPolicyHeader
public static void ensureContentSecurityPolicyHeader(jakarta.faces.context.FacesContext facesContext, ContentSecurityPolicy contentSecurityPolicy) -
ensureNosniffHeader
public static void ensureNosniffHeader(jakarta.faces.context.FacesContext facesContext) -
ensureNosniffHeader
public static void ensureNosniffHeader(jakarta.servlet.http.HttpServletResponse servletResponse) -
ensureXFrameOptionsHeader
@Deprecated(since="6.11.0", forRemoval=true) public static void ensureXFrameOptionsHeader(jakarta.faces.context.FacesContext facesContext) Deprecated, for removal: This API element is subject to removal in a future version.Remove X-Frame-Options HTTP header, because it is covered by the CSP directive "frame-ancestors".
-